> As he cross-examined the coroner, the defense attorney asked,  
>"Before you signed the death certificate, had you taken the 
> man's pulse?"
>"No," the coroner replied.
>"Oh?  Did you check for breathing?"
>"No."
>"So, when you signed the death certificate," the attorney asked 
> with a smirk, "you had not taken any steps to make sure the 
> man was dead, had you?"
>"Let me put it this way,"  the badgered coroner replied. 
>"The man's brain was sitting in a jar on my desk.  But,"  
> he added, "I guess that he could still be out there practicing law >
somewhere."
